The 3rd Smart City Exchange Forum with the theme "Collaboration drives innovation: City-to-City, Research & Innovation partnerships" is held on 26. of January, 2023 and aims to enhance the cooperation and networking between researchers, cities, policy makers, companies and other relevant stakeholders for developing sustainable, resilient, and smarter urban environment.

3rd Smart City Exchange Forum

The main focus of 3rd Smart City Exchange Forum is on the collaboration structures between cities and their Research and Innovation ecosystems.

The event will be opened by the mayors of Tallinn and Helsinki. Presentations are done by various representatives of cooperation projects of the UN and the most prominent cities in Europe, such as NetZeroCities, UNDP Urban Learning Center, etc. In addition, FinEst Centre for Smart Cities will introduce its large-scale piloting programme what is carried out in six different cities in Estonia.

As in 2023, the city of Tallinn will be hosting the European Green Capital title then 3rd Smart City Exchange Forum Day is co-hosted by the City of Tallinn.

Smart City Exchange Forum will take place on Thursday, January 26, 2023, from 10: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. in the Tallinn Teachers' House (Town Hall Square 14), followed by a reception until 7:00 p.m.
